2012-11-28 10 views
6

Ben native dizinde BUILDING.txt yönergeleri takip ve buradaMac OS X Mountain Lion'da mod_jk'yi nasıl oluştururum?

./configure --with-apxs=/usr/sbin/apxs 

gcc /usr/bin değildi çünkü çıkış Doğal

building connector for "apache-2.0" 
checking for gcc... /Applications/Xcode.app/Contents/Developer/Toolchains/OSX10.8.xctoolchain/usr/bin/cc 
checking for C compiler default output file name... configure: error: C compiler cannot create executables 
See `config.log' for more details. 

bazıları, ben çözümler için StackOverflow arandı olduğunu yürüttü. Bu yüzden açık XCode'u açtım ve Komut Satırı Araçları'nı kurdum. GCC şu anda/usr/bin'deydi ... ama aynı hatayı almaya devam ediyorum.

Herhangi bir fikrin var mı?

cevap

20

Bir saatlik kazma işleminden sonra, sonunda this post'a girdim ve benim sorunumla ilgilenen yanıtlarımı ekledim.

Bunun için ilk önce SONRA Eğer bu Mac OS X 10.8 elma tarafından sağlanan apsx bir sorundur

sudo ln -s /Applications/Xcode.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ain /Applications/Xcode.app/Contents/Developer/Toolchains/OSX10.8.xctoolchain 

yürüterek bu sembolik oluşturmak zorunda XCode dan Komut Satırı Araçları yüklemeniz gerekir. Configure betiği, /usr/sbin/apxs -q CC'u çalıştırarak C derleyicisini bulmaya çalışır. Yol çıkışı yanlış ya da Apple 10.8'i yükledikten sonra sizin için sembolik bağlantı oluşturmayı unutmuş. Eğer sembolik oluşturduktan sonra

herşey yolunda olacak ve mod_jk olmayan apaçık

+0

Çok faydalı bilgiler, derlemek mümkün olacak. – sotapme

+0

Çok bilgilendirici. Bana yardımcı oldu. –

+0

Seni seviyorum dostum! –